Retail TouchPoints and design:retail Reveal the 40 Under 40 Class of 2021

Retail TouchPoints and design:retail have selected the next class of the 40 Under 40 — the top 40 professionals in the retail industry under the age of 40 who are paving the way for the next era of retail. This year, the publications expanded nominations to include all roles and job functions in the retail ecosystem — from ecommerce and marketing to innovation and store design.

After receiving the largest nomination pool in the competition’s seven-year history, the editorial team culled down the list to the top 40 young professionals in the retail community who met the following criteria:

  • Shining stars in their company and in the industry;
  • Have completed innovative and remarkable work; and
  • Contribute greatly to education or associations supporting the retail community.

The 2021 class of impressive leaders is comprised of founders, CEOs, creative directors, design managers, marketing executives, ecommerce gurus, VPs and many more changemakers rewriting the rules of retail in unique and exciting ways.

“We are proud to continue the legacy of the 40 Under 40 Awards program, recognizing the achievements and outstanding work of the retail industry’s next generation of leaders,” said Jessie Dowd, Senior Editor of Retail TouchPoints. “Elevating those individuals who have used their brilliant minds and dedicated drive to propel retail forward is essential to fostering continued innovation across the industry at large.”
